Ceremony Announces Seventh Album 'Tell Me Your Dream' After Seven-Year Hiatus

By

Danielle Chelosky

17d ago· 3 min readenNews

Summary

Ceremony, the California punk band known for genre shifts, announces their seventh studio album Tell Me Your Dream — their first in seven years, following 2019's synthpop turn In The Spirit World Now. The album announcement is accompanied by the new single "Death Destruction Mayhem." Vocalist Ross Farrar emphasizes the band's intent to respond to the current era of mass uncertainty through punk music, questioning why more punk bands aren't addressing the current political, economic, and spiritual climate.
